Flexibility, hospitality, care: how far should services go?

Context: 
The transformation of working methods has led to skyrocketing expectations regarding the work environment. Hospitality management, care, shared spaces, concierge services, flexible catering... Companies have multiplied their offerings to restore the appeal of the office, which has been undermined by the rise of remote working.
But with this service-oriented approach gaining momentum, one question stands out: where should the line be drawn? And how can we assess the relevance, consistency, and sustainability of these offerings in a context of growing economic constraints?

Key questions:
•    How can we avoid overdoing it or creating a “catalog” effect?
•    Which services really create value for employees and organizations?
•    How can services be coordinated to ensure a smooth and consistent experience?
•    Can a service offering be managed as a performance lever, rather than simply as a cost?
•    How can the need for adaptability be reconciled with economic and asset management imperatives?
